The Boy Band Con: The Lou Pearlman Story (working title The Lou Pearlman Project) is an American documentary film that premiered on March 13, 2019 at SXSW. Produced by Lance Bass , the film explores the career and legacy of record producer and convicted criminal Lou Pearlman .

Louis Byron Perryman (August 15, 1941 – April 1, 2009), also known as Lou Perry, was an American character actor. He acted in a number of small roles both on television and in films such as The Blues Brothers, Poltergeist, Boys Don't Cry and The Texas Chainsaw Massacre 2. He was a film crew member on the original Texas Chainsaw Massacre film.
